* In Istio sidecars, historically we had a lot of client-specific xDS. For example, putting the xDS-client's IP back into the xDS response. This makes efficient control plane implementation (most notably, caching), extremely challenging. * In practice, this largely means that references are fully qualified in the API. IP Addresses (generally) have a network associated with them, node names have a cluster associated with them, etc.
